    Distibution of seats in maharashtra medical colleges admitting students through MHT-CET

    This article is intended to give a gist of distribution of seats in those Maharashtra medical colleges admitting students on basis of merit in MHT-CET exam. For courses other than MBBS and BDS, please check the brochure.

    • 15% seats of the college are reserved from AIPMT candidates
    • Remaining 85% seats are available for MHT-CET candidates.
    • 70% of the 85% seats are reserved for candidates from the region(ROM/Marathwada/Vidharbha) in which the college is located.
    • Remaining 30% of the seats are reserved for candidates from regions other than that of the medical college. Candidates from the same region are also eligible for these seats.
    • Both 70 and 30% are then divided in approx 50% for common(open) category and the remaining 50% is divided among Constitutionally reserved categories like SC, ST, OBC, NT,VJ, etc.
    • Apart from these constitutionally reservations special reservations such as Govt. of India(GOI), HA, MKB, Def, etc. are applied.

    The above scheme may vary on yearly basis. For latest and accurate information, please refer the MHT-CET Health Science brochure.
